About This Item

New York, NY, U.S.A.: Ballantine Books, 1996. 1st ed. reading creases, one small tear at rear cover, edgewear else a very good to near fine copy of this Paperback Original. A SHAMUS AWARD NOMINEE. A Nashville PI Harry James Denton title . First Edition. Mass Market Paperback. Near Fine. Paperback Original.
